Best time to go to Molesworth

The best time to visit Molesworth can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Molesworth falls in January,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Molesworth falls in July,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January74.7°F (23.7°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
February72.5°F (22.5°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
March67.5°F (19.7°C)Light RainSunnyHighAverage
April59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
May52.2°F (11.2°C)No R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
June47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
July46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
August47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
September51.6°F (10.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
November64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December69.6°F (20.9°C)Light RainSunnyHighSlightly High

What is the best area to stay in Molesworth?
The best area to stay in Molesworth is directly within the village centre, particularly for those looking to enjoy the Great Victorian Rail Trail.The village centre of Molesworth is quite compact, with the main amenities clustered around the Goulburn Valley Highway. You'll find the general store and local pub here, serving as central points for visitors. The most significant feature is its direct access to the Great Victorian Rail Trail, which runs right through the village. This makes it an ideal stop for cyclists and walkers.Couples often find Molesworth a charming and convenient base for exploring the rail trail. You can easily rent bicycles locally or bring your own, and the flat, scenic trail offers a lovely way to spend a day together, stopping at various points of interest or other small towns along the route.
